Rare encounters with K-Country wolf surprise visitors, make Alberta Parks staff wary

A lone grey wolf encountered by multiple people in Kananaskis Country has possibly become acclimated to the presence of humans, according to Alberta Parks. Wolves are seldom seen in the Bow Valley, especially up close, making these encounters rare and potentially problematic.

AHS declares presumed E. coli, amoebiasis outbreak at Saskatoon Farm food facility

Alberta Health Services says 18 people have tested positive for presumptive E. coli — three of whom also tested positive for a parasite that causes amoebiasis — in an outbreak at Saskatoon Farm. So far, 235 people have reported symptoms linked to this outbreak.

Signal Hill residents on high alert after brass address signs stolen

Several Signal Hill residents say brass plaques bearing their home addresses have been stolen, causing issues for delivery and ride share services, which cannot locate the homes, and raising concerns among community members.
